In debug, the wddialout command allows you to see the specific packet that
caused the Max to dial out. You can use this packet to either build a
filter, or determine what you have set on your PC that is causing the
dial-out.

But I use Windows 95, NT 3.51 and 4.0 and Linux and have no spurious
dialouts. It's all in the PC configuration.
